Bill Bensing is a creator and seasoned technology leader with 11 years of experience shaping software delivery, governance, and inclusive engineering cultures. He co-authored a book on automated governance and builds assurance-first tooling as the founder/creator of NAPE and co-founder/CTO of Attestify, merging policy-as-code with real-time risk practices. Previously a managing architect at Red Hat and architect/CTO roles across startups and enterprises, he specializes in embedding security, compliance, and audit into the software lifecycle to drive Business-IT alignment. Bill is also a podcast host and community builder who reframes Shadow IT as a constructive force and advocates for socio-technical solutions that scale. Outside of governance, he applies engineering to ocean farming, brews beer, studies programming language history, and writes open-source software—demonstrating a hands-on, curious approach to technical problems. Based in Saint Petersburg, FL, he combines entrepreneurial grit with practical tooling that “builds things that build things.”
